Transcription

Jan 24 ‘91
J. C. Goodridge Jr. Esq.
113 E 25th St.
New York
Dear Sir :-
After consulting Mr. Edison he instructs me to say that he wants the survey extended 300 ft. further on the west and south far enough to take in altogether the 150 acres as originally agreed upon. I have just wired you, therefore, to cancel order for Room to meet me at Drakesville. Instead please have him extend the survey as soon as possible. I suppose there would be no objection to leaving the present survey stand as it is and making another to cover the ground. The following sketch shows what we want.
Yours truly
C. J. Reed [enclosed sketch of survey]
